Just when it seemed like things were all quiet on the “Twilight” front — save for a few updates from actress Nikki Reed and screenwriter Melissa Rosenberg — “Entertainment Tonight” reports that “Pacific” star Rami Malek will be joining the “Breaking Dawn” cast as Egyptian vampire Benjamin.

Jason Statham, Sylvester Stallone and Randy Couture in “The Expendables”
Photo: Lionsgate
#1 “The Expendables” ($5 million)
#2 “Vampires Suck” ($4.4 million)
#3 “Lottery Ticket” ($3.9 million)
#4 “Piranha 3D” and “Eat Pray Love” ($3.6 million)
#6 “The Other Guys” ($2.9 million)
